Graduates of Lamar University's bachelor's program in Foods, Nutrition, and Related Services earn a median $31,089 one year after graduating, rising to $62,818 by year ten. Five years out, earnings run 11% below the national median of $60,856 for this field, ranking 33rd of 45 reporting programs.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au PSEO, release V4.13.0 2025Q4. Earnings are for graduates working in covered states; figures are medians in nominal dollars.
